The
Right
Direction
Most
tennis
courts
face in
the
north to
south
direction.
The
reason
for this
is so
that the
sun does
not
become a
factor
when
hitting
the
ball.
Have you
ever
tried to
drive
and look
into the
sun?
Well,
that
should
give you
an
indication
of how
difficult
it is
playing
on a
east
west
facing
court.

Here are the tennis court dimensions. Is where you play the
correct size?

Measurements
Length - Baseline to Baseline - 78ft.
Width - Singles sideline to Singles sideline - 27ft.
Doubles sideline to Doubles sideline - 36ft.
Doubles Alley - 4-1/2ft. wide
Service Boxes - 13-1/2 ft. wide
Service Box length - 21ft. long
Distance from Service Box to Baseline - 21ft.
Distance from Baseline to fence - 21ft.
Distance from Fence to Fence in Length - 120'
Distance from Doubles sideline to nearest obstruction - 12ft.
min.
Net Height - 36in. at center - 42in. at both ends
Court Lines - 2in. - Baselines - 4in.
Fence Height - Residential - 8ft.
Fence Height - Parks and clubs - 10ft.
Overall size - 7200sq.ft. - 60ft.x120ft.

Tennis
is more
of a
stop and
go sport
with
quick
bursts
of speed
followed
by the
ability
to
recover
quickly.
These
are
things
that
long
distance
running
are not
geared
to
provide.
Especially
in light
of the
way that
you
participate
when
playing
tennis.
As an
example,
let's
say that
you play
a point
and you
get
winded.
Your
ability
to
recover
can mean
the
difference
in
whether
you will
win or
lose the
points
following
that
one.
